Wal-Mart must pay workers $78m Wal-Mart must pay workers $78m
The world's largest retailer, Wal-Mart, has been ordered to pay at least $78m (£42m) in compensation to workers who were forced to work during breaks.
A jury in a Pennsylvania court decided...
